---
title: "Como corrigir o FAQ Schema do Rank Math que não valida"
url: https://full.services/wp-fixer/corrigir-faq-schema-rank-math/
date: 2026-06-17
author: "Clayton Margiotti"
---

# Como corrigir o FAQ Schema do Rank Math que não valida

## O que é FAQ Schema do Rank Math que não valida?

O FAQ Schema do Rank Math é o JSON-LD do tipo FAQPage que o plugin injeta na página a partir do bloco FAQ by Rank Math (ou de um schema FAQPage montado no Schema Generator). Quando esse markup não é gerado, sai incompleto ou é recusado pelo Rich Results Test, dizemos que o FAQ Schema não valida. Na prática o problema quase nunca é o plugin: o Rank Math só emite o FAQPage para itens que tenham pergunta E resposta preenchidas e que estejam de fato visíveis no HTML público da página.

Vale separar dois efeitos distintos. Um é o schema inválido, com erro no Rich Results Test (campo obrigatório faltando, item vazio, conteúdo do schema diferente do texto visível). O outro é o schema válido que mesmo assim não vira rich result: desde agosto de 2023 o Google passou a mostrar o resultado rico de FAQ apenas para sites de governo e saúde, então um FAQPage perfeito pode validar e ainda assim não exibir o sanfonado na busca. Distinguir os dois evita horas perdidas tentando corrigir algo que está correto.

## Como identificar

- No Rich Results Test do Google aparece a mensagem 'No items detected' mesmo com o bloco FAQ na página

- O Rich Results Test acusa erro 'Either name or text must be specified' ou 'Missing field acceptedAnswer' no item de FAQ

- A aba Schema do Rank Math mostra o FAQPage, mas o JSON-LD não está no código-fonte da página publicada (Ctrl+U não acha 'FAQPage')

- O validador do Schema.org marca o item de FAQ como vazio ou sem a propriedade 'acceptedAnswer'

- O Google Search Console reporta 'FAQ inválidos' ou para de mostrar o aprimoramento de Perguntas frequentes no relatório

## Como prevenir

- Sempre revise cada par pergunta e resposta antes de publicar; itens em branco quebram o FAQPage inteiro

- Mantenha o FAQ dentro do conteúdo do post (bloco nativo), não em widgets de tema ou page builder fora do the_content

- Inclua a purga de cache no checklist de publicação, especialmente em sites com WP Rocket, LiteSpeed ou CDN

- Padronize que o texto do schema seja idêntico ao texto visível na página para evitar recusa por content mismatch

- Lembre a equipe de que FAQ Schema válido não garante rich result desde agosto de 2023; meça pelo Search Console, não pela prévia visual

Erros relacionados

- [Como corrigir marcação inválida no Schema Generator do Rank Math](https://full.services/wp-fixer/corrigir-schema-generator-rank-math/)

- [Como corrigir rich snippets inválidos no Schema do WordPress](https://full.services/wp-fixer/corrigir-rich-snippets-schema-invalido/)

- [Como corrigir schema markup quebrado no WordPress](https://full.services/wp-fixer/corrigir-schema-markup-quebrado-wordpress/)


---

## Metadados Estruturados (Schema.org)

```json-ld
{
    "@context": "https://schema.org",
    "@graph": [
        {
            "@type": "Organization",
            "@id": "https://full.services/#org",
            "name": "FULL Services",
            "url": "https://full.services/",
            "sameAs": [
                "https://www.instagram.com/fullservicesbr",
                "https://www.facebook.com/fullservices.br",
                "https://www.linkedin.com/company/fullservicesbr/"
            ],
            "knowsAbout": [
                "WordPress",
                "WordPress Hosting",
                "Web Development",
                "Performance Optimization",
                "WordPress Security",
                "SEO para WordPress"
            ],
            "award": [
                "Gold Medal - The WP Weekly Awards 2023",
                "Gold Medal - The WP Weekly Awards 2024"
            ],
            "logo": {
                "@type": "ImageObject",
                "url": "https://full.services/wp-content/uploads/full-services-logo.png",
                "width": 200,
                "height": 60
            },
            "hasCredential": {
                "@type": "EducationalOccupationalCredential",
                "credentialCategory": "certification",
                "name": "CVE Numbering Authority (CNA)",
                "description": "Autoridade de numeração de vulnerabilidades (CVE) para o ecossistema WordPress, autorizada a atribuir IDs CVE. Válida desde 2022-05-03, com abrangência global.",
                "url": "https://www.cve.org/PartnerInformation/ListofPartners/partner/FULL",
                "recognizedBy": {
                    "@type": "Organization",
                    "name": "CISA — Cybersecurity and Infrastructure Security Agency",
                    "url": "https://www.cisa.gov/",
                    "sameAs": "https://www.cisa.gov/"
                }
            }
        },
        {
            "@type": "TechArticle",
            "@id": "https://full.services/wp-fixer/corrigir-faq-schema-rank-math/#article",
            "headline": "Como corrigir o FAQ Schema do Rank Math que não valida",
            "url": "https://full.services/wp-fixer/corrigir-faq-schema-rank-math/",
            "inLanguage": "pt-BR",
            "datePublished": "2026-06-17T12:39:31-03:00",
            "dateModified": "2026-06-17T12:39:46-03:00",
            "author": {
                "@id": "https://full.services/#org"
            },
            "publisher": {
                "@id": "https://full.services/#org"
            },
            "isAccessibleForFree": false,
            "about": [
                {
                    "@type": "Thing",
                    "@id": "https://www.wikidata.org/wiki/Q13166",
                    "name": "WordPress",
                    "sameAs": "https://www.wikidata.org/wiki/Q13166",
                    "url": "https://wordpress.org/"
                },
                {
                    "@type": "Thing",
                    "name": "SEO Tecnico"
                }
            ],
            "mentions": {
                "@type": "Thing",
                "@id": "https://www.wikidata.org/wiki/Q13166",
                "name": "WordPress",
                "sameAs": "https://www.wikidata.org/wiki/Q13166",
                "url": "https://wordpress.org/"
            },
            "mainEntityOfPage": {
                "@type": "WebPage",
                "@id": "https://full.services/wp-fixer/corrigir-faq-schema-rank-math/"
            },
            "wordCount": 924,
            "description": "O Rank Math FAQ Schema não valida quando algum par pergunta/resposta fica vazio, quando o bloco FAQ não é renderizado no conteúdo público da página, ou quando o cache serve uma versão antiga sem o bloco. O markup só sai como FAQPage se cada item tiver pergunta e resposta preenchidas.",
            "articleSection": "SEO Tecnico",
            "keywords": "bloco faq rank math sem schema, faq by rank math nao gera schema, faq schema rank math nao valida, rank math faqpage erro rich results, validar faq schema rank math",
            "proficiencyLevel": "Intermediate",
            "citation": {
                "@type": "CreativeWork",
                "url": "https://rankmath.com/kb/rich-snippets/",
                "name": "Rank Math — How Schema (Rich Snippets) Works"
            },
            "mainEntity": {
                "@type": "SoftwareSourceCode",
                "name": "Como corrigir o FAQ Schema do Rank Math que não valida",
                "programmingLanguage": "JavaScript",
                "codeRepository": "https://full.services/wp-fixer/corrigir-faq-schema-rank-math/",
                "isAccessibleForFree": false
            }
        },
        {
            "@type": "FAQPage",
            "@id": "https://full.services/wp-fixer/corrigir-faq-schema-rank-math/#faq",
            "isPartOf": {
                "@id": "https://full.services/wp-fixer/corrigir-faq-schema-rank-math/#article"
            },
            "isAccessibleForFree": true,
            "mainEntity": [
                {
                    "@type": "Question",
                    "@id": "https://full.services/wp-fixer/corrigir-faq-schema-rank-math/#faq-q1",
                    "name": "Por que o FAQ Schema do Rank Math não aparece no código-fonte?",
                    "inLanguage": "pt-BR",
                    "acceptedAnswer": {
                        "@type": "Answer",
                        "text": "Quase sempre porque algum item do bloco FAQ está com pergunta ou resposta vazia, ou o FAQ é renderizado fora do the_content por um widget de page builder. O Rank Math só injeta o FAQPage para itens completos e visíveis no conteúdo do post.",
                        "author": {
                            "@id": "https://full.services/#org"
                        }
                    }
                },
                {
                    "@type": "Question",
                    "@id": "https://full.services/wp-fixer/corrigir-faq-schema-rank-math/#faq-q2",
                    "name": "O Rich Results Test diz que o FAQ é válido mas não mostra o resultado rico. Por quê?",
                    "inLanguage": "pt-BR",
                    "acceptedAnswer": {
                        "@type": "Answer",
                        "text": "Desde agosto de 2023 o Google só exibe o rich result de FAQ para sites de governo e saúde. Um FAQPage válido em um site comum continua correto, mas não gera o sanfonado na busca; isso é política do Google, não erro do seu site.",
                        "author": {
                            "@id": "https://full.services/#org"
                        }
                    }
                },
                {
                    "@type": "Question",
                    "@id": "https://full.services/wp-fixer/corrigir-faq-schema-rank-math/#faq-q3",
                    "name": "Preciso do Rank Math PRO para gerar FAQ Schema?",
                    "inLanguage": "pt-BR",
                    "acceptedAnswer": {
                        "@type": "Answer",
                        "text": "Não. O bloco FAQ by Rank Math e o JSON-LD do tipo FAQPage estão na versão gratuita. O PRO adiciona o Advanced Schema Editor e variáveis de custom field, úteis para casos complexos, mas o FAQ básico funciona sem ele.",
                        "author": {
                            "@id": "https://full.services/#org"
                        }
                    }
                },
                {
                    "@type": "Question",
                    "@id": "https://full.services/wp-fixer/corrigir-faq-schema-rank-math/#faq-q4",
                    "name": "O que significa o erro 'Either name or text must be specified' no FAQ?",
                    "inLanguage": "pt-BR",
                    "acceptedAnswer": {
                        "@type": "Answer",
                        "text": "É o Rich Results Test avisando que um item de FAQ está sem a pergunta (name) ou sem a resposta (text). Volte ao bloco FAQ, localize o item incompleto, preencha os dois campos e atualize a página para regerar o schema.",
                        "author": {
                            "@id": "https://full.services/#org"
                        }
                    }
                },
                {
                    "@type": "Question",
                    "@id": "https://full.services/wp-fixer/corrigir-faq-schema-rank-math/#faq-q5",
                    "name": "Cache pode fazer o FAQ Schema não validar?",
                    "inLanguage": "pt-BR",
                    "acceptedAnswer": {
                        "@type": "Answer",
                        "text": "Sim. Se o plugin de cache ou o CDN serve uma versão da página gerada antes de você inserir o bloco FAQ, tanto o visitante quanto o Google recebem o HTML antigo sem o JSON-LD. Purgar o cache após salvar resolve esse caso.",
                        "author": {
                            "@id": "https://full.services/#org"
                        }
                    }
                },
                {
                    "@type": "Question",
                    "@id": "https://full.services/wp-fixer/corrigir-faq-schema-rank-math/#faq-q6",
                    "name": "Posso usar o mesmo FAQ em várias páginas?",
                    "inLanguage": "pt-BR",
                    "acceptedAnswer": {
                        "@type": "Answer",
                        "text": "Não é recomendado. O Google considera Q&A duplicado em muitas páginas como motivo para ignorar o markup. Escreva perguntas e respostas específicas de cada página e mantenha o texto do schema igual ao texto visível.",
                        "author": {
                            "@id": "https://full.services/#org"
                        }
                    }
                },
                {
                    "@type": "Question",
                    "@id": "https://full.services/wp-fixer/corrigir-faq-schema-rank-math/#faq-q7",
                    "name": "Como faço o FAQ Schema aparecer em um Custom Post Type?",
                    "inLanguage": "pt-BR",
                    "acceptedAnswer": {
                        "@type": "Answer",
                        "text": "Habilite o módulo Schema do Rank Math para aquele tipo de conteúdo em Rank Math, Configurações do Schema, e então adicione o bloco FAQ ou um FAQPage manual no Schema Generator. Sem o módulo ativo para o CPT, nenhum JSON-LD é injetado.",
                        "author": {
                            "@id": "https://full.services/#org"
                        }
                    }
                }
            ]
        }
    ]
}
```
